On average across the year,
yes, Belgium is hotter than
Oshawa, Ontario
.
Belgium has an average temperature of 11°C/52°F and Oshawa, Ontario has an average temperature of 9°C/48°F.
Belgium's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 23°C/73°F, which is not hotter than Oshawa, Ontario's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 26°C/79°F).
On average across the year, no, Belgium is not colder than Oshawa, Ontario . Belgium has an average minimum temperature of 8°C/46°F and Oshawa, Ontario has an average minimum temperature of 5°C/41°F.
On average across the year,
no, Belgium has less rain than
Oshawa, Ontario. Belgium has an average annual rainfall of 506mm and Oshawa, Ontario has an average annual rainfall of 938mm.
Belgium's wettest month is June, with an average monthly rainfall of 56mm, which is drier than Oshawa, Ontario's wettest month (also June, with an average monthly rainfall of 107mm).
